Zusammenfassung:The immune cells, especially innate immune cells (Natural Killer cells and Macrophages) residing at the maternal-fetal interface are playing critical roles during pregnancy. Here we discuss the immunological characteristic at the maternal-fetal interface during normal pregnancy. These key decidual immune cells are reshaped of their uterus-specific homeostatic functions within this uterus microenvironment. Through emphasizing the similarities and differences between decidua immune microenvironments with tumor or transplantation immune microenvironments, distinctive immune cell niche with activated, tolerant, proangiogenic and nurturing characteristic at the maternal interface is exhibited. Deeper understanding of the immunological microenvironment during pregnancy yield important insight not only into the pathogenesis of various human pregnancy complications, but also suggest ways to better manipulate these immune cells in cancer and transplant organs. •The immune cells, residing at the maternal-fetal interface constitute very special immunological interface during pregnancy.•Similarities between NK cells in reproductive and tumor immune microenvironment reflect the plasticity of NK cells.•The assumption that maternal immune system must be suppressed to make tolerance to the semi-allogeneic fetus is misleading.•Maternal immune system during pregnancy should not be fully suppressed for normal pregnancy.•The immune cells at the maternal interface show activated, tolerant, proangiogenic and nurturing characteristic.
